        The real winners in all of this are the Cable/PPV providers. They get paid first and make at least 50% and don't have to pay expenses or fighters.

        This fight can easily lose money and both Shaeffer and Espinoza said it.

        They aren't getting anything from the MGM for a site fee.

        They are getting less than $2 million in sponsors but spend over $80 million in marketing.

        Merchandise only does a couple hundred thousand.

        Most of the money from the movie theaters goes to the theaters and its parent company.

        I'm estimating the break even number for this fight is over 2 million buys and this fight doesn't do 1.5

        Is CBS/SHO loses money again ppl are gonna end up missing.
